The net estate is inclusive of home that gone by the legislations of intestacy, testamentary building, and testamentary replacements, as enumerated in EPTL 5-1.1-A. New York's category of testamentary alternatives that are included in the net estate make it challenging for a dead partner to disinherit their enduring spouse. In neighborhood residential property territories, a will certainly can not be made use of to disinherit a surviving partner, who is entitled to a minimum of a part of the testator's estate. Various other territories will either neglect the effort or hold that the entire will was in fact withdrawed. A testator may likewise have the ability to withdraw by the physical act of one more (as would certainly be required if she or he is physically incapacitated), if this is done in their existence and in the visibility of witnesses. Some jurisdictions might presume that a will has been destroyed if it had actually been last seen in the possession of the testator yet is found mutilated or can not be discovered after their death. in Texas. To be legitimate, a holographic will needs to be composed completely in your handwriting and authorized by you. As long as you comply with these two requirements, you do not require witnesses to make your holographic will certainly legitimate. A Straightforward Will is one where a person leaves their whole estate to their partner or partner or, if that partner pre-deceases them, they leave their whole estate instead to any type of youngsters they have actually had together.
